Load Cell - Application, Advantages, and Types
A load cell, as the name suggests, is employed to transform force into a readable electrical output. It is also known as a force transducer and converts tensions, pressure, compression or even torque into measurable output. 2-Channel Vibrating-Wire Analyzer Module
With an AVW200 vibrating-wire analyzer module, your data logger can measure vibrating-wire strain gages, pressure transducers, piezometers, tiltmeters, crackmeters, and load cells. These sensors are used in a wide variety of structural, hydrological, and geotechnical applications because of their stability, accuracy, and durability.
